White House Press Secretary Jen Psaki said on Friday that U.S. President Joe Biden would be travelling to Capitol Hill amid ongoing talks over an infrastructure spending bill and a social-spending bill, to “make the case” for his legislative agenda. Progressives have vowed to block the $1 trillion infrastructure bill without an agreement to advance a larger social spending and climate change bill, while moderates say that bill’s current $3.5 trillion price tag is too high.
